Strategic Evolution: Commercial Transport in North Korea

In the evolving landscape of North Korean industrial modernization, the demand for efficient, reliable, and low-maintenance cargo transportation has surged. As the DPRK continues to focus on its "Five-Year Plan for Economic Development," the logistics of moving goods between Special Economic Zones (SEZs) like Rason, Sinuiju, and Kaesong and major hubs like Nampo Port requires a new generation of commercial vehicles.

Almax Auto is a comprehensive automotive export service company dedicated to promoting Chinese automobiles to the global market. For many years, we have focused on new and used car exports, leveraging China's strong automotive manufacturing and supply chain advantages to provide global clients with efficient, safe, and transparent one-stop automotive export solutions.

Our headquarters are located in China, with automotive export bases in Wuhu and Guangzhou, covering the entire process from vehicle procurement, inspection, preparation, customs clearance, and logistics. Simultaneously, we have established offline stores and service centers in Cambodia, Algeria, and Rwanda, providing overseas clients with vehicle display, sales, and after-sales support.
